Examples of languages that use dynamic scope include Logo, Emacs Lisp, LaTeX and the shell languages bash, dash, and PowerShell. Some languages, like Perl and Common Lisp, allow the programmer to choose static or dynamic scope when defining or redefining a variable. Advantages of static scoping: Readability Locality of reasoning Less run-time overhead Disadvantages: Some loss of flexibility Advantages of dynamic scoping: Some extra convenience Disadvantages: Loss of readability Unpredictable behavior (no locality of reasoning) More run-time overhead Static and Dynamic Systems – Theory | Solved Examples. In C, variables are always statically (or lexically) scoped i.e., binding of a variable can be determined by program text and is independent of the run-time function call stack. (2) Dynamic scoping, depending on language, looks up the variables by the current activation stack (from most nested outward) rather than by the static scope. With dynamic scoping things are a bit different. Each entry in the callstack represents a different scope to check for the variable a. Because there is no a defined in the function referencing it, we traverse up the call stack to find a declared variable. It’s found in the body of run_func, where the value is 200.
